.banner { text-align: center; padding: calc(var(--spacer) / 5) calc(var(--spacer) / 2); border-bottom: 1px solid var(--border-color); background-color: var(--background-content); } .banner.error { background-color: var(--brand-alert-red); color: var(--brand-white); } .banner.warning { background-color: var(--brand-alert-yellow); color: var(--brand-white); } .banner.success { background-color: var(--brand-alert-green); color: var(--brand-white); } .banner > div { display: inline-block; } .text { font-size: var(--font-size-small); font-weight: var(--font-weight-bold); margin: 0; margin-right: calc(var(--spacer) / 4); text-align: center; } .text a { color: inherit; text-decoration: underline; } .link { color: inherit; text-decoration: underline; text-transform: inherit; font-size: var(--font-size-small); } .text p:last-child { margin-bottom: 0; }